Please pull this fix for 4.9.

>From JJ: "This is a fix for a policy replacement bug that is fairly 
serious for apache mod_apparmor users, as it results in the wrong policy 
being applied on an network facing service."

apparmor: fix change_hat not finding hat after policy replacement

After a policy replacement, the task cred may be out of date and need
to be updated. However change_hat is using the stale profiles from
the out of date cred resulting in either: a stale profile being applied
or, incorrect failure when searching for a hat profile as it has been
migrated to the new parent profile.

diff --git a/security/apparmor/domain.c b/security/apparmor/domain.c
index fc3036b..a4d90aa 100644
--- a/security/apparmor/domain.c
+++ b/security/apparmor/domain.c
@@ -621,8 +621,8 @@ int aa_change_hat(const char *hats[], int count, u64 token, 
bool permtest)
/* released below */
cred = get_current_cred();
cxt = cred_cxt(cred);
-   profile = aa_cred_profile(cred);
-   previous_profile = cxt->previous;
+   profile = aa_get_newest_profile(aa_cred_profile(cred));
+   previous_profile = aa_get_newest_profile(cxt->previous);
 
if (unconfined(profile)) {
info = "unconfined";
@@ -718,6 +718,8 @@ int aa_change_hat(const char *hats[], int count, u64 token, 
bool permtest)
 out:
aa_put_profile(hat);
kfree(name);
+   aa_put_profile(profile);
+   aa_put_profile(previous_profile);
put_cred(cred);
 
return error;
